I was in an IXB and C, but later restarted a new career in a Type VII B cause my patrols were just too damn long.
Admittidly ive edited my basic.cfg files so the VIIB can equip everything an VIIC can.
I like the VIIB because its a wee bit farther in surface range, and is 1 knot faster submerged. The downside is the lack of later upgrades and dive time. Well i sort of "fixed" the upgrades, and live with the 3 second longer dive time.
Ive also used time travellers depth mod. It will allow th VII a max depth of like 260. I like going deep, but i do like limitations. Using said depth mod, you can make a VIIC go 300 meters, a C/41 350, and a c/42 400.
Tempting, but i think its overkill.
So all told i like my modifed version of a VIIB, as modding your own game goes, its a great compromise.

For me it's the Type VIIC.
I used to like the Type IX's, but being sent to far off corners of the ocean got a tad bit boring for me - I want to get there NOW!
The Type II's are great...for a few patrols, before I get frustrated with their small loadouts.
The VIIC is a perfect compromise, plus it's readily upgradable as the war progresses.
